Transaction f5337560e1cdf26bf1cb5f3b71deeb2cf2d308991ae8e869fd76ffbcd3db2897
1 Input
1 Output
-
f5337560e1cdf26bf1cb5f3b71deeb2cf2d308991ae8e869fd76ffbcd3db2897:0
- value
- 383898
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ba87dcce7dfd7fae4c363bfdfe8f18a12a3cb0a OP_EQUAL
- address
- 34DG1iDWLwjarqT7KGxUS5xaZ9wm59pNuC